Context-dependent function implies that the behavior of a certain system is subject to certain circumstances or surroundings. Some synonyms for this term include variable, fluctuating, adaptable, dynamic, and situational. The expression "variable" means that the system is likely to change from one environment to another. The term "fluctuating" suggests that the system is subject to highs and lows, meaning that its performance may be unstable. "Adaptable" means that the function can adjust to different situations and adapt to new conditions. "Dynamic" echoes the idea of flexibility, while "situational" means that the behavior of the system might be affected by a particular set of circumstances.
